Bank of Scotland Marine Finance at Seawork for the first time

13-15 June 2006

« Back

Bank of Scotland Marine Finance, a familiar name in the leisure marine market and an active player in the global shipping market for many years will be exhibiting at Seawork for the first time.

Over recent years the company has secured funding for UK based companies to purchase plant and machinery, pontooning and commercial vessels including ships, tugs and barges. Paul Ratcliffe, Asset Finance Manager-Marine, will be available throughout the show to offer funding advice for visitors and fellow exhibitors.

Paul commented, 'I am looking forward to exhibiting at Seawork. I have visited the show for many years and realise its business potential for a company such as ours. Bank of Scotland has considerable experience in the commercial marine sector and has an astute understanding of the business sector, its pressures and client expectation. As flexibility and suitability of funding is a crucial factor for the ongoing success and profitability of any business, we consider the potential use and lifetime of the asset to be purchased when discussing funding options. I will be delighted to discuss any visitor's funding enquiries during the show or make arrangements to visit them at a later date in more confidential surroundings.'

The marine asset finance division is able to supply funds in sterling, euros and dollars and can call upon the skilled resources of the company's global shipping division if complex, larger funding requests are received.
